Something that I don't understand, if it is supposed to be illegal, then why is there software being sold to help remove DRM?

I was doing some checking as I am seriously considering it, I bought some books online, not knowning that they were DRM'd. I thought they were DRM free, as one said epub and the others were Adobe.

Anyhow, there is software being sold, I have seen two different types offered. So, what is going to happen there? Those businesses will be shut down? Charges brought against them?

I am just getting confused about DRM and ADOBE and ADE, if you have to download ADE to install a book, doesn't that mean it is DRM'd? And isn't Calibre unable to process DRM books? So, if I have to download ADE to be able to put books on my reader (Sony 900), doesn't that mean the books are DRM books and doesn't that mean I can't use Calibre? Therefore, I have to strip the books to be able to read them, right?

I have been bouncing from thread to thread, reading all the posts trying to understand this.
And I am getting more confused than straightened out.
Yes, if you are required to open the book with ADE, that's "DRM". As explained, Calibre is of very limited use in dealing with those, in terms of editing them (adding missing cover art, for example). You do not need Calibre to actually read them.
